Antique, new and vintage luggage racks are practical pieces of furniture frequently found in hotels and other hospitality properties. While a sophisticated mid-century modern luggage rack might catch your eye in your favorite design-destination hotel, it can also make for a charming addition to a guest room or other space in your home.
A luggage rack is typically a simple piece of furniture with flexible straps or a flat surface to hold suitcases and other travel bags. They became popular in the late 19th century when large Louis Vuitton and Goyard trunks occasionally proved cumbersome on long trips. Instead, they carried suitcases.
The vintage luggage racks you commonly see are made of wood or metal with pliable straps. However, they exist in a variety of materials; a bamboo luggage rack can evoke the allure of distant places. An evolution in the design of luggage racks has brought with it embellishments to make them look more interesting or add some color.
